ok do it , Just remember that you need to make sure you tell her to not spread it around.
You can't put that Genie back in the bottle. As they say you can only keep a secret if only you know it. Once you tell anyone, expect it it get around. Maybe fast, maybe slow. I have told people and never expected silence. In some cases they didn't say anything. In other cases spouses and family members soon knew about me.
The question should be are you ready for the world to know. Most of us here who have come "out" so to speak are older and have suffered the darkness long enough that we don't care anymore. You reach an age, it varies with each person, when you start to careless about what people think about you. You have established your reputation and maybe become more comfortable with who you are personally and financially. You know who you are. If you come out to anyone, expect that with time everyone will know. If you are ready for that, do it.
